4 Browsers here.
Waterfox: - Waterfox: Sandboxed, only Waterfox.exe, and plugin-container.exe can access the internet. Internet Requests from plugin-container yield a prompt for block/allow from KIS 2013 and large amounts of the web are blocked via peerblock and ranges in KIS 2013. Waterfox is primarily my Youtube browser. It carries updated version of Flash and Java. Shredded with Eraser on sandbox close. - TorBrowser: Sandboxed, only tor.exe can access the internet, generally my web browser of choice no flash, no java, and no javascript (Thank you noscript) this and the torification (Not to mention various other addons) of my traffic makes me feel less "Followed" on the internet. Shredded on close. - Opera, only used for my E-Mail. No plugins of any kind. Portable installation. Shredded on close. - Internet Explorer, I don't use it and software restriction policies (Not to mention deny rules in KIS) keep it from running but because I feel like Microsoft has ran it so deep within the system I can't live without it I leave it be. All browsers are kept up to date.
